
About Jack Hyde
Recognized by his peers as a Missouri and Kansas Super Lawyers Rising Star in litigation every year since 2015 Currently representing clients in high-stakes civil litigation across the United States Jack Hyde represents both plaintiffs and defendants in a wide range of civil litigation cases, with an emphasis in the areas of personal injury, wrongful death, product liability and professional liability. In 2024, Jack received the Thomas J. Conway Award from the Kansas City Metropolitan Bar Association, recognizing a lawyer with courage and zeal for the client and a collegial attitude toward fellow lawyers. Jack grew up in Springfield, Missouri, and graduated from Drury University with a B.A. in biology and art history. He later earned his law degree from the University of Missouri Kansas City School of Law. After working as a law clerk for Wagstaff & Cartmell throughout law school, Jack began practicing with the firm following his graduation.
